【发布时间】:2012-09-06 12:00:54
【问题描述】:
您好,我需要一个用于比较黑莓软件版本的代码。如果黑莓设备软件版本高于 OS 6,则继续应用程序,否则提示用户对话框首先显示升级操作系统并退出应用程序。
【问题讨论】:
标签: blackberry java-me
您好,我需要一个用于比较黑莓软件版本的代码。如果黑莓设备软件版本高于 OS 6,则继续应用程序,否则提示用户对话框首先显示升级操作系统并退出应用程序。
【问题讨论】:
标签: blackberry java-me
有比您描述的更好的方法。
使用预处理器和alx-task 为不同的操作系统版本构建不同的应用程序版本。
然后您将拥有一个 alx + 一组包含 cod 文件的文件夹,其中每个文件夹都有特定平台版本的 cod 文件。根据连接的设备操作系统版本,Alx 文件将包含从合适文件夹安装 cod 文件的指令。
【讨论】:
您可以使用以下内容:
String deviceOS = DeviceInfo.getPlatformVersion();
【讨论】: